com.atlassian.confluence.links
Interface ReferralManager

All Known Implementing Classes:
DefaultReferralManager

public interface ReferralManager

Author:
Ara Abrahamian (ara_e_w@yahoo.com)

Method Summary
 int deleteReferrersWithPrefix(java.lang.String urlPrefix)
           
 java.util.List<ReferralLink> getHotReferrers(ContentEntityObject content, int maxCount)
           
 void referToContent(com.atlassian.bonnie.Handle entityHandle, java.lang.String referrerUrl, int hitCount)
           
 void saveReferralLink(ReferralLink link)
           
 void saveTrackback(com.atlassian.trackback.Trackback tb, long entityId)
           
 

Method Detail

referToContent

void referToContent(com.atlassian.bonnie.Handle entityHandle,
                    java.lang.String referrerUrl,
                    int hitCount)

getHotReferrers

java.util.List<ReferralLink> getHotReferrers(ContentEntityObject content,
                                             int maxCount)

saveReferralLink

void saveReferralLink(ReferralLink link)

saveTrackback

void saveTrackback(com.atlassian.trackback.Trackback tb,
                   long entityId)

deleteReferrersWithPrefix

int deleteReferrersWithPrefix(java.lang.String urlPrefix)


Copyright © 2003-2014 Atlassian. All Rights Reserved.